January on the ground
Weather & conditions
Cold, windy plains winter. Highs near 36°F, lows near 16°F.
A stay-flexible off-season month — winter camping is possible on mild stretches, but the wind asks a lot of any rig.
What to do in January
- Winter raptors along the river-road drives
- Museum days in Omaha and Lincoln
- Quiet Platte River overlooks before crane season
Best-fit rigs: Motorhome · Truck or van
Know before you go
Ground blizzards and wind chill are the real hazards; I-80 closes during bad events.

January tips for Nebraska
Nights dip to freezing or below: insulated water hose, tank protection or a winterized rig, and extra propane.
Carry traction boards and check chain requirements before any mountain route.
Plan shorter driving days — winter-pattern daylight is limited and campground offices close early.
